Fireworks at Barrowford & Fair play to Tom in NY

October ended with a bang for Elle Anderson at Podium 5k in Barrowford where she smashed her PB with a 1st sub 17 time of 16:48. Elle was part of a three person LPS team with Nick Turner finishing in 17:34 and Andrew Foster 17:53. Over the same weekend Dan Brookfield achieved his PB in […]

News July 2008

Rimmer back on course By his high standards Michael Rimmer has had an indifferent run up to the Olympics. Among other performances he has recorded a 1.47.2 800m in Berlin and a 1.47.10 in Ostrava, season`s best by a UK runner but some way off other international performers.
